Q: Is 43,038,543 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 43,038,543 is a composite number.

Why is 43,038,543 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 43,038,543 can be evenly divided by 1 3 17 23 51 69 391 1,173 36,691 110,073 623,747 843,893 1,871,241 2,531,679 14,346,181 and 43,038,543, with no remainder.

Since 43,038,543 cannot be divided by just 1 and 43,038,543, it is a composite number.
